About claude-in-mobile

Claude Mobile MCP server for mobile and desktop automation — Android (via ADB), iOS Simulator (via simctl), Desktop (Compose Multiplatform), and Aurora OS (via audb). Like Claude in Chrome but for mobile devices and desktop apps. Control your Android phone, emulator, iOS Simulator, Desktop applications, or Aurora OS device with natural language through Claude.
